First thing’s first, you gotta figure out what kinda Timex Expedition watch you got. Some got them little screws on the back, others, well, they don’t. Mine, it didn’t have no screws, so that made things a bit easier, I reckon. But if you got them screws, you gonna need one of them tiny screwdrivers, the kind you use for eyeglasses, maybe.

Changing the Battery

Gettin’ that back off, that’s the tricky part. I used a little butter knife, real careful-like. Just gotta pry it open a bit. Don’t go forcing it, you might break somethin’.

  • Find that little notch on the back of your Timex Expedition watch.
  • Wedge that knife in there, real gentle.
  • Give it a little twist, and pop, it should come off.

Now, once you get that back off, you’ll see the watch battery. It’s a little round fella, usually silver. Mine was held in place by this tiny little piece, I don’t even know what you call it. I think it was a T shaped bracket. Whatever it was, it was held down by a screw. It was so small I almost missed it. I used my tiny screwdriver to loosen it. Be careful not to lose it when you take it off. Then, I lifted the T shaped bracket up. And, there it was. The old watch battery was right there.

I used the tip of my knife to pop out the old Timex Expedition watch battery. It was held in place with a little clip. You can use your fingers if you want. I just figured the knife was easier. I think the old battery was stuck in there pretty good.

Finding the Right Battery

Before you even start, you gotta make sure you got the right watch battery. You can check your old one, or look it up somewhere. I think mine was a CR2016, but don’t quote me on that. They ain’t too expensive, a few dollars, maybe. You can get ’em at most stores that sell batteries, I reckon. I went to the general store up the road, and they had a whole bunch of ’em. Just make sure you get the right one.

Timex Expedition Watch Battery Change: Dont Pay a Shop, Do It Yourself

Putting in the New Battery

Once you got the new watch battery, you just gotta pop it in where the old one was. Make sure the shiny side is facing up, that’s important. Then, you gotta put that little cover back on, if your watch has one, and screw it down tight, if you have screws. I put the T bracket back over the new battery. Then, I put that little screw back in and tightened it down. Again, be careful. It is a small screw. And, don’t overtighten it.

Then, you just gotta put the back of the watch back on. Just line it up and press it down until it clicks. And that’s it, you’re done!
